DB | Assay description | Assay Type | Standard value | Standard parameter | Original value | Original units | Original parameter | Reference |
---|---|---|---|---|---|---|---|---|
TRPV4/Transient receptor potential cation channel subfamily V member 4 in Human (target type: SINGLE PROTEIN) [ChEMBL: CHEMBL3119] [GtoPdb: 510] [UniProtKB: Q9HBA0] | ||||||||
ChEMBL | Antagonist activity at human TRPV4 | B | 8.7 | pIC50 | 2 | nM | IC50 | ACS Med Chem Lett (2021) 12: 1498-1502 [PMID:34531959] |
ChEMBL | Inhibition of human TRPV4 expressed in baculovirus infected HEK/MSR 2 cells pre-incubated for 10 mins followed by GSK634775A addition by Fura-2 dye based FLIPR assay | B | 8.74 | pIC50 | 1.8 | nM | IC50 | ACS Med Chem Lett (2019) 10: 1228-1233 [PMID:31413810] |
ChEMBL | Antagonist activity at human TRPV4 | B | 8.74 | pIC50 | 1.8 | nM | IC50 | J Med Chem (2019) 62: 9270-9280 [PMID:31532662] |
GtoPdb | - | - | 8.82 | pIC50 | 1.5 | nM | IC50 | ACS Med Chem Lett (2019) 10: 1228-1233 [PMID:31413810] |
TRPV4/Transient receptor potential cation channel subfamily V member 4 in Rat (target type: SINGLE PROTEIN) [ChEMBL: CHEMBL2775] [GtoPdb: 510] [UniProtKB: Q9ERZ8] | ||||||||
ChEMBL | Inhibition of rat TRPV4 expressed in baculovirus infected HEK/MSR 2 cells pre-incubated for 10 mins followed by GSK634775A addition by Fura-2 dye based FLIPR assay | B | 8.8 | pIC50 | 1.6 | nM | IC50 | ACS Med Chem Lett (2019) 10: 1228-1233 [PMID:31413810] |
